数据结构及算法八股文
时间: 2023-08-15 15:06:32 浏览: 241
八股文与算法(网络,数据库,设计模式,数据结构 ).zip
回答: 数据结构及算法八股文是指在面试中常被问到的一些关于数据结构和算法的基础知识问题。其中包括递归算法和非递归算法的区别和应用场景。递归算法是通过利用重复结构来简洁地解决问题,但需要跟踪每个嵌套调用的状态的活动记录,因此在计算机内存成本高时,可以将递归算法转换为非递归算法,通常使用堆栈结构来实现。\[1\]基数排序是一种要求数据可以划分成高低位,并且位之间有递进关系的排序算法,每一位的数据范围不能太大,需要借助桶排序或计数排序来完成每一位的排序工作。\[2\]\[3\]在实际应用中,快速排序、堆排序和归并排序也有各自的应用场景。
#### 引用[.reference_title]
- *1* [数据结构与算法总结(八股文)](https://blog.csdn.net/qq_37207042/article/details/119462193)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^koosearch_v1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* *3* [数据结构与算法的八股文自述(持续更新)](https://blog.csdn.net/qq_39350172/article/details/116244240)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^koosearch_v1,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文